REBECCA MANLEY PIPPERT Recognized nationally and internationally as a prominent speaker and author, Rebecca Pippert is founder of Salt Shaker Ministries: a teaching/training ministry that serves to help believers understand what they believe and then how to communicate faith effectively. Having ministered extensively around the world, and having lived in Europe and the Middle East as an adult, Becky has a global perspective on being a sensitive and effective witness for Christ whether in the Post-modern West or the Global South. Becky is the author of nine books that include the modern classic, Out of the Salt Shaker, which was named recently by Christianity Today as one of the books that has most influenced Christian thought in the past 50 years. Her books have been translated into over 25 languages. Described by Chuck Colson as one of the “liveliest and most effective communicators of the gospel in the world today,” Becky has spoken extensively to churches through out the U.S., and she has given conferences in Latin America, Canada, Southeast Asia, Central Asia, India, Europe, Australia and the Middle East. For 2 years she was a monthly columnist for the Christian Korean magazine Salt and Light and she is an Advisory board member for the Billy Graham Center in Wheaton, IL. Becky has also spoken multiple times to the LPGA golf pros, and she is a frequent guest on Moody Bible Radio Broadcasts as well as Janet Parshall’s America! Her book, Hope Has Its Reasons, addresses the common questions held by seekers and skeptics about faith, and her book, A Heart for God, addresses themes of how God uses suffering and trials to produce character and faith. Her most recent 6 volume book set: Salt Shaker Resources: An Evangelism Tool Kit, won the award for Best Evangelism Resource for 2003 and the first book in that series, Talking About Jesus Without Sounding Religious, won Best Evangelism Book for 2003 by Outreach Magazine. Becky received an honorary doctorate and holds a B.A. and M.A. with High honors in English literature from the University of Illinois. She has done advanced study at the University of Barcelona, Harvard University, and she studied at the [former] American Institute in Jerusalem, Israel. She is married with two college aged children and she and her husband reside in Louisville, Kentucky.
